FrontAccounting 2.0 (Default branch)

Image FrontAccounting is a Web-based accounting system for ERP chains. It is multiuser, multilingual, and multicurrency. License: GNU General Public License (GPL) Changes:
A new company logo. GL summaries in Tax Report. The first registered admin (company 0) now becomes 'Global-Admin' for all company admins. Currency selection in the Price Listing Report. Customer Dimension overrides an Item Dimension when creating GL transactions. Better calculation of price diff during PO receive and PO invoice. Elimination of voiding of dangerous items. Replacement of the PDF engine. Full support for Unicode and right-to-left (utf8bidi).Image

SLURMSTEPD(8)							 Slurm components						     SLURMSTEPD(8)

NAME
slurmstepd - The job step manager for SLURM. SYNOPSIS
slurmstepd DESCRIPTION
slurmstepd is a job step manager for SLURM. It is spawned by the slurmd daemon when a job step is launched and terminates when the job step does. It is responsible for managing input and output (stdin, stdout and stderr) for the job step along with its accounting and sig- nal processing. slurmstepd should not be initiated by users or system administrators.
